Output 508c3b44af17cbfa56889b547952d4008340d4b031ac0a7c20b5b0fc69b60082:51

value
141466240
script pubkey
OP_0 OP_PUSHBYTES_20 80a5360bab4ca2391f4ef7711380146505b88efb
address
bc1qszjnvzatfj3rj86w7ac38qq5v5zm3rhmq5twve
transaction
508c3b44af17cbfa56889b547952d4008340d4b031ac0a7c20b5b0fc69b60082
spent
true